Job Description

Dealer Branding & Visual Merchandising

  • Conduct regular visits to dealer showrooms to ensure in-store branding and product displays meet company standards.
  • Optimize visual merchandising to enhance product visibility and customer experience.
  • Identify and recommend improvements for in-shop branding and display aesthetics.

Internal Coordination

  • Liaise with Sales and Dispatch teams to ensure timely delivery of tiles and samples for dealer displays.
  • Coordinate with the Marketing team for planning and executing retail branding initiatives.

Branding & Marketing Execution

  • Supervise the distribution, installation and upkeep of branding materials such as different signboards, stickers, printing press materials etc.
  • Support national/regional campaigns, promotional events, dealer engagement activities etc.

Market Feedback & Competitor Insights

  • Collect on-ground feedback from dealers and customers.
  • Monitor competitor branding activities and share actionable insights.
  • Submit visit reports with photographic documentation and observations.

Inventory & Documentation

  • Maintain detailed records of branding materials allocated to dealers.
  • Track inventory usage and plan for timely replenishment of promotional items.
